原文:awk命令之NF和$NF區別

NF number of field :域的個數 NF :最后一個Field 列 ...

2017-08-11 11:01 0 1923 推薦指數:

查看詳情

Linux awk命令NF和$NF區別

一.awk中$NF是什么意思? NF代表:瀏覽記錄的域的個數。 $NF代表 :最后一個Field(列) 二.awk下面的變量NF和$NF有什么區別? {print NF} 也有{print $NF} 前者是輸出了域個數,后者是輸出最后一個字段的內容 ...

Fri Jun 09 06:45:00 CST 2017 0 1532
awkNF的使用

統計 機器中網絡連接各個狀態個數 netstat -a | awk '/^tcp/ {++S[$NF]} END {for(a in S) print a, S[a]}' 一下子不明白$NF是什么意思,去查了下awk的用法,發現 NF表示瀏覽記錄的域的個數 ...

Thu Jan 04 08:20:00 CST 2018 0 4294
NF

NF的歌給人一種他活得很痛苦,但是他很憤怒,還有反擊余地的感覺。 我永遠是NF的粉絲 ...

Mon Feb 14 22:23:00 CST 2022 0 709
awkNF,NR的含義

awkNF和NR的意義,其實你已經知道NF和NR的意義了,NF代表的是一個文本文件中一行(一條記錄)中的字段個數,NR代表的是這個文本文件的行數(記錄數)。在編程時特別是在數據處理時經常用到。建議你看看有關awk編程方面的資料,這可是一個功能非常強大的工具。 看個例 ...

Sat Mar 07 19:03:00 CST 2015 0 6670
關於awk中NR、FNR、NF、$NF、FS、OFS的說明

一、NR和FNR 1.釋義 NR: 表示當前讀取的行數 FNR:當前修改了多少行 2.舉例 比如現在AWK處理到第五行。第一行沒有進行操作,2,3,4,5行進行了操作,那么NR=5,FNR=4 NR==FNR 表示從起始行到當前行,awk都進行了操作 ...

Tue Apr 18 22:13:00 CST 2017 0 2100
關於awk中NR、FNR、NF、$NF、FS、OFS的說明

一、NR和FNR1.釋義NR: 表示當前讀取的行數FNR:當前修改了多少行2.舉例比如現在AWK處理到第五行。第一行沒有進行操作,2,3,4,5行進行了操作,那么NR=5,FNR=4NR==FNR 表示從起始行到當前行,awk都進行了操作,比如修改,添加等等 ;二、NF和$NF1.釋義NF:瀏覽 ...

Mon May 31 00:25:00 CST 2021 0 3985
第一范式(1NF)、第二范式(2NF)和第三范式(3NF)的區別

第一范式(1NF):   列1唯一確定列2, 列3, 列4, ...,即列2, 列3, 列4, ...不能再分裂出其它列。   假設有關系模式列1: 訂單名; 列2: 商品。一個訂單下可以有多個商品,即列2: 商品可以分裂成商品A, 商品B, 商品C, ...,所以列1: 訂單 ...

Fri Feb 18 18:24:00 CST 2022 1 1249
shell腳本,awk利用NF來計算文本顯示的行數。

解釋: 1.awk 'NF{a++;print a,$0;next}1' file4 首先判斷NF是否存在值,第一行第二行第三行第四行都存在,進行執行后面的輸出,輸出后碰到next后,就結束了后面的操作,NF不存在的行不進行執行{}里面的操作,然后就進行默認1輸出。 2.awk 'NF ...

Mon Nov 28 09:48:00 CST 2016 0 10225
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M